just modded my wii u with aroma and tiramisu, and i'm curious if wii games run the same in vWii as in Wii VC injects? are there any major differences visual quality or play wise or is it just launching the same thing from a forwarder of sorts?

Wii VC injects allow you to run Wii mods and GameCube games without needing to hack your vWii (but it is still needed for WiiWare injects), to use the Wii U GamePad and, for compatible homebrews, to overclock your vWii.
The vWii, outside VC injects, allow you to play disc games, to install and play their channels (for example, installing the Mario Kart channel from a Mario Kart Wii VC inject won't work) and to use homebrews which don't work with injections (for example, the Homebrew App Store for Wii).
Outside of these aspects, it's the same. The greatest visual quality a Wii game can offer on Wii U is 480p, whether you're running it with the vWii or a Wii VC inject.

I heard with vWii +USB loaders you can turn off deflicker to get clearer video output, but with VC injects you cannot do this.
Another perk for vWii is you can use cheats.

You can technically do both of these with VC injections, it just sucks a lot.

To disable deflicker you need to unpack the disc image with a tool like Wiimms ISO Tool, e.g. wit x mariokartwii.wbfs mkwii then you can search the main.dol for the following code fragment:
Code:
99498000 90E98000 99498000 91098000 41820040
That last one is a conditional branch, you can replace it with a forced branch to skip over enabling the deflicker filter:
Code:
99498000 90E98000 99498000 91098000 48000040
That's identical except for the last part (4800...) which forces the branch. I don't know how reliable this exact byte sequence is, it's just the one I've encountered when looking at this. It's code from one the SDK libraries, so it should be broadly the same across all games, but it might change with different SDK versions, e.g. depending on when the game came out.

For using cheats in VC titles, you again need an unpacked image (like I did with wit above), then you need a compiled GCT cheat file (like your USB loader can make or this online tool), and lastly you need Wiimms StaticR Tool. Then you can apply your GCT to your main.dol with wstrt patch main.dol --add-section mycheats.gct.

Then you can rebuild your image with something like wit copy mkwii mariokartwii-hacked.wbfs or whatever your preferred format is and lastly inject that file with your injection tool.

So like I said, it sucks.
